Sturdy

Three-wheeled strollers are an excellent choice for fitness enthusiasts seeking a jogging pushchair or parents seeking a multi-purpose pushchair. They are durable, reliable and safe. They also offer many features that make them a perfect option for your needs.

In contrast to four-wheel strollers, 3 wheel strollers are smaller design. This makes them more maneuverable and easier to turn in tight spaces. This is an enormous benefit for parents living in urban areas that are crowded. They also have one front wheel and are therefore more stable than their 4-wheel counterparts. They are also lighter than their four-wheel counterparts making them easier to carry and lift into your vehicle.

Many three-wheeled models like strollers that jog, have suspension systems. This is a kind of built-in shock absorber, which protects your child from bumpy surfaces and uneven sidewalks. The wheels on these models are larger than the four-wheeled models, which provides more comfort for your child.

Some 3-wheel strollers are equipped with a canopy to shield your child from the sun. The canopies are available in a variety styles, ranging from simple squares of fabric that is strung between two wires made of metal to a large pull-down canopy that covers the entire front of the stroller. Some have a clear plastic "peek-a-boo" window at the top, so you can keep an eye on your baby.

Another thing to consider is the kind of surface you will use the stroller on. If you'll be primarily strolling on level surfaces, foam or air-filled tires are a great choice. But if you'll be traveling on rough terrains or hiking trails solid tires are the best choice.

Easy to maneuver

There are a variety of strollers available. It is important to pick the one that best suits your needs and preferences. Three-wheeled strollers are more maneuverable and easier to navigate than four-wheeled strollers. They also have larger wheels, which may provide a more comfortable ride for your child. This makes them larger and heavier, which can impact their storage and transport.

For optimal control, joggers should select 3 wheel stroller with car seat-wheeled strollers that have a fixed front tire. They should also examine the terrain they typically encounter during walks and run to make sure that the stroller is able to take on the bumps and dips along their route.

When selecting a stroller, you must also think about how easy it is to fold and unfold. Many parents have trouble with folding their strollers and finding a stroller that's easy to fold and easy to set up is essential. A stroller must also include a tray or pocket that can be stowed away to hold essentials for parents.

The majority of three-wheeled strollers, especially those designed for jogging have larger wheels than traditional strollers. They can be used on any surface and are able to be able to withstand bumpy terrain. They are typically air-filled and are made of rubber. They absorb shocks and provide a comfortable ride for children. However, these wheels can be prone to flats and need regular maintenance. If you're worried about this, you can select a stroller with steel-rimmed tires or an all-terrain wheel set. This will allow you to avoid any costly repairs or replacements later on.

Convenient

If you're an active parent who is enthralled by the excitement of running, or you're seeking a stroller to accompany your baby on his daily adventures, strollers with three wheels offer many possibilities. They are lightweight and easy to maneuver and they have a range of features to accommodate your requirements.

3 wheel Stroller And car seat-wheeled strollers are very convenient because they can pivot and maneuver effortlessly in tight spaces. They are also lighter and more compact than four-wheeled strollers. They are also easier to move into and out of cars. In addition, they are less likely to tip over than four-wheelers because the weight is evenly distributed.

If you intend to use the stroller on uneven terrains, it is a good idea to get one with wheels that are air-filled. This type stroller can be used to navigate bumpy sidewalks or other obstacles. You can also pick one that has a suspension system that functions as a built-in shock absorber to ensure your child's comfort.

There are also strollers that are designed to ease your life by offering features such as a one-handed folding mechanism and spacious storage baskets. These features will help you manage your daily chores without having to break a sweat. Many 3 wheel travel stroller-wheeled strollers are available in attractive designs and colors to let you express yourself. Test drive several models before you make the final decision if you're looking to purchase new strollers. You'll want to make sure that it is comfortable and fits your budget and lifestyle. Test the brakes and safety harnesses and ensure that the handlebars are easily accessible and easy to grab.
